Adventureworks 2008 sql queries pdf

Installing adventureworks sample database my tec bits. Installing sample databases for sql server 2008r2 steve. This is a sample dataedo documentation adventureworks microsoft sql server sample database. Can embed queries in whereclauses sophisticated selection tests. Adventureworks database for sql server 2008 solutions. Also, the earlier version of the adventureworks sample databases are being released for sql. The original adventureworks family continues to ship for sql server 2008, so you have a choice of staying with the compatible schema or trying out the new sql server 2008 features depending on which installers you download. May 23, 2007 sql server 2005 does not install sample databases by default due to security reasons. It covers most of the topics required for a basic understanding of sql and to get a feel of how it works. Sql server 2008 interview questions and answers part. Adventureworks oltp a standard online transaction processing database containing a year of data of. The set of work stations on the shop floor where the product is built.

Mar 07, 2018 later, sql server 2000 was released containing a northwind database script along with pubs. For more information on attaching database files, see attach a database. Sql server 2005 introduced sqlcmd as the command line query interface. Productmodelillustration 7rows 52 crossreferencetablemappingproductmodelsandillustrations. Advanced sql queries, examples of queries in sql list of top. Upon successful install, we were able to connect to our database server and expand the installed databases. A majority of the examples in this book use the adventureworks database sql server 2008. Teaching tip active learning via a sample database. There are versions for sql server 2000, 2005 and 2008, but this post is concentrated on the 2008 versions.

One is the manual import using the sql server backup import wizard. Sep 18, 2008 pinal dave is a sql server performance tuning expert and an independent consultant. This release contains the full database backups, scripts, and projects for adventureworks2008r2. Install and configure adventureworks sample database sql server. Adventureworks sample databases are used in code examples in sql server books online and in companion samples that you can install in microsoft sql server 2008. Use the adventureworks2008 database to complete this exercise. The adventureworks database supports standard online transaction processing scenarios for a fictitious bicycle manufacturer adventure works cycles. Mcsa sql server training writing queries firebrand training.

Release adventureworks2008r2 microsoftsqlserversamples. They are for use with sql server 2008r2 and later versions. Aug 29, 2008 there are versions for sql server 2000, 2005 and 2008, but this post is concentrated on the 2008 versions. This book contains plenty of examples that let you see how areas of sql server work and how. Certain exercises for beginners are provided on the site, they are supplied with the necessary reference source on sql syntax with a great number of examples.

Exercises are growing in difficulty, from the most basic to others a bit more complicated, where youd get data from more than on table in the. Later, sql server 2000 was released containing a northwind database script along with pubs. Availability of adventureworks sample databases for sql. In an interview, what matters the most is conceptual knowledge and learning attitude. Id like to install adventureworks2008 i just install sql server 2008 r2 express each time i download the recommended version from codeplex, all i get is a adventureworks2008. Adventureworks sql with manoj sql server, sql queries. Adventureworks oltp a standard online transaction processing database containing a year of data of data for a fictitious bicycle manufacturer adventure works cycles. Sql i about the tutorial sql is a database computer language designed for the retrieval and management of data in a relational database. Additionally, if youre trying to learn sql server, its a good idea to follow certain blogs. Sql includes commands to work with data at the table level. Install sql server express set up adventureworks database adventureworks sample database microsoft provides the adventureworks database for learning about databases and tsql. Feb 28, 2008 the original adventureworks family continues to ship for sql server 2008, so you have a choice of staying with the compatible schema or trying out the new sql server 2008 features depending on which installers you download. Adventureworks sample databases for sql 2005 zen and the.

Adventureworks and adventureworksdw are the example databases found in sql server if you selected. Id like to install adventureworks2008 i just install sql server 2008 r2 express. Sql is incredibly powerful, and like every wellmade development tool, it has a few commands which its vital for a good developer to know. The result is that a file called adventure works dw 2008r2. Each of the queries in our sql tutorial is consequential to almost every system that interacts with an sql database. Microsoft sql server historical sample database diagram tour. Part i getting started with microsoft sql server 2008. The adventureworks 2008 family of sample databases building.

Jun 02, 2016 once sql server 2016 is available for general public and adventureworks 2016 is also available, i will post a new article on adventureworks 2016. Stored procedure using a recursive query to return the direct and indirect managers of. Writing simple select queries this section provides solutions to the exercises on writing simple select queries. After the release of sql server 2005, a project team was formed with an idea to build the next sample database adventureworks. Using the select statement use the adventureworkslt2008 database to complete this. He is the cofounder of sql cruise, llc, a training company for sql server specializing in deepdive sessions for small groups, hosted in exotic and alternative locations throughout the world.

Over the years northwind was also replaced by more advanced sample database. Finally, the paper lessons learned using discusses adventure works in different advanced is courses, and two. Adventureworks manufacturing instructions document schema april 2014 description this schema describes construction information about groups of related products for the adventureworks and adventureworks2008 family of sample databases. Solutions to the exercises the appendix provides answers to the exercise questions in chapters 2 through 8. Sample databases adventureworks 2014 for sql server 2014 has been released and is ready for download.

Sql server is a very large subject and not everything is usually asked in an interview. Sql server 2005 does not install sample databases by default due to security reasons. Tim is a sql server mvp, and has been working with sql server for over ten years. Adventureworks and advetureworksds are the new sample databases for sql server 2005, they can be download from here. I have received many questions regarding where is sample database in sql server 2005. Employeeid, but this value changes as the sql server database engine examines different rows in employee. In this chapter, you will learn about some of the new functions and advanced queries available with these most recent releases. Nov 25, 2010 in a previous post, we walked through installing sql server 2008 and the adventure works databases. The sql queries 2012 handson tutorial for beginners sql exam prep series 70461 volume 1 of 5 sql queries 2012 joes 2 pros microsoft official course 2778a.

He has authored 12 sql server database books, 33 pluralsight courses and has written over 5100 articles on the database technology on his blog at a s. Basic sql queries using adventureworks cold logics. This is my very humble attempt to write sql server 2008 interview questions and answers. It can be run either on the same computer or on another across a network. How to install the sample adventureworks database onto sql. Scenarios include manufacturing, sales, purchasing, product management. Code girl tsql problem set 1 aunt kathis sql server home. Let us learn how to install northwind database samples databases. Sql provides broad support for nested subqueries a sql query is a selectfromwhere expression nestedsubqueriesare selectfromwhere expressions embedded within another query. If you do not yet have a sql server in azure, navigate to the azure portal and create a new sql. You can use those samples to illustrate the sales summary and comparisons. Install sql server express set up adventureworks database adventureworks sample database microsoft provides the adventureworks database for learning about databases and t sql. Pinal dave is a sql server performance tuning expert and an independent consultant.

The adventureworks 2008 family of sample databases. Adventureworks manufacturing instructions document schema. Not only i cannot attach the file from sql server management studio, but i cannot copypaste the file directly into the the database. In chapter 9 you learned about some exciting new data types that microsoft introduced with sql server 2005 and 2008. New versions of the adventureworks sample databases for sql server 2008 are now available. List of complex sql queries for practice part 2 techhowdy. The adventureworks databases are available on codeplex. Each time i download the recommended version from codeplex, all i get is a adventureworks2008. Exercises are growing in difficulty, from the most basic to others a bit more complicated, where youd get. More information adventureworks sample databases are used in code examples in sql server books online and in companion samples that you can install in microsoft sql server 2008. Sql server 2008 installing the adventureworks sample.

Choose the adventureworksda2008r2 cube for ssas 2008 r2. Download the a zip file containing the scripts needed to install adventureworks. Adventureworksbased exercises needed for practice learn more on the sqlservercentral forums. Not only i cannot attach the file from sql server management studio, but i. Performance tuning with sql server dynamic management. A correlated subquery can also be used in the having clause of an outer query. Many books and webinars use this database for the examples.

Sql server northwind database or adventureworks database. Sql joins tutorial for beginners inner join, left join, right join, full outer join duration. The previous subquery in this statement cannot be evaluated independently of the outer query. Install and configure adventureworks sample database sql. Can embed queries in fromclauses issuing a query against a derived relation. Referencing a single table multiple times in the same query. Performance tuning with sql server dynamic management views. Immerse yourself in sql server, brent ozar unlimited. Sql server 2008 interview questions and answers part 7. This product is built for the basic function of storing retrieving data as required by other applications. Part of setting these up for testing, i usually end up installing the sample. Adventureworks is a sample database for microsoft sql server 2008 to 2014. Lets take a moment to explore our surroundings a little bit. Those blogs will often have queries based on adventureworks.

After the file is attached, you will have the adventureworks database installed on your sql server instance. This query can be executed repeatedly, one time for each row that may be selected by the outer query. Ms sql sever i about the tutorial ms sql server is a relational database management system rdbms developed by microsoft. Before you run it go to the query menu and select sqlcmd mode, and in the query. If you successfully deploy adventureworks sample reports, you can browse reports under the adventureworks sample reports folder. In this course, you have learned to write tsql queries against data stored in. The sample includes various flavors of samples that you can use with sql server 2014, and are. Those reports require sql server analysis services and sql reporting services. Sql inner joins and left join adventure works examples. In ms sql server, you can import the backup database file adventureworks. Follow these instructions to download and install adventureworks sample databases with sql server management studio or in azure sql database. Sql exercises is intended for acquiring good practical experience, which is focused on data operation, namely on sql dml. At least to get started, we will also use adventureworks. Installing sample databases for sql server 2008r2 steve stedman.

To download the database, go to the link below and download the adventureworks 2008 oltp script. Adventureworks is the name of the sample database, which replaces the old pubs database from earlier versions of sql server, and the northwind sample database from sql server 2005. Adventureworks sql with manoj sql server, sql queries, db. Awbuildversion 1row 1 currentversionnumberoftheadventureworks2012sampledatabase. This is the data warehouse sample database useful for playing with business intelligence features of the sql server. All of the examples within this book utilize the adventureworks and adventureworksdw. Advanced sql queries, examples of queries in sql list of. Installing sample databases for sql server 2008r2 stevestedman posted on april 17, 20 posted in sql 2008 no comments v as i work on testing the database health reports project, i have configured several test servers running as virtual machines using hyperv.

This is a documentation of this database created with dataedo adventureworks database supports standard online transaction processing scenarios for a fictitious bicycle manufacturer adventure works cycles. Sql server 2008 interview questions and answers codeproject. Click on sql server 2008 r2 oltp and you will be directed to the downloads page for sql server 2008 r2. In a previous post, we walked through installing sql server 2008 and the adventure works databases. Scenarios include manufacturing, sales, purchasing, product management, contact management, and human resources. For microsoft sql server analysis services 2008 beginning sql 2012 joes 2 pros volume 1. About the databases there are several versions of the adventureworks databases out there. The general adventureworks sample which is commonly used in sql server database engine. Open sql management studio, connect to the instance, and open c.

811 1282 1365 1341 1468 558 680 25 508 1118 592 1401 529 295 1136 1036 1123 207 94 427 1429 107 1220 424 421 300 1064 1443 1399 219 1268 1354 101 758 161 644 232 1096 1256 19 707